@Skill4Reel The class system was never that, people didn't purposely join games and play 'classes' and did the 'teamwork' but everything was designed around the idea that if you were to embrace the system it could make you a better player and had a certain satisfaction level. It used to be that if you were to attack helo and you were solo vs a attack helo of 2 GG you are most likely losing that.
But they designed so much in 2042 that you can ignore all that and still be nearly as effective it really doesn't matter anymore how you play. I like Zain, I was always a fan of the airburst in 2142 but Zain atm has a auto heal after killing someone, you get 1🏈 med pens, you can have C5 and you have a 'grenade' launcher.... it's just too much same with how many other specialists are designed.
Hell they are even supposedly buffing the health regen after taking damage instead of just adding back the system where you can resupply health/ammo from support classes by pressing a button near them..... elegant system. These things are the 'class' system and 'teamplay' elements that are enough to make it a Battlefield game imo, but it has to be the core of every design decision they make.
Just see it as the 'class' system and 'teamplay' as an subconscious thing about the game not something everyone HAS to consciously be aware of. If designed well it happens organicly.
Atleast in my years of Battlefield is what I feel the Battlefield DNA is about.

Another thing I do actually miss in Battlefield is special things, controlling a full aircraft carrier, big weapon installement, mortars, weapons of mass destruction... special things, things when you see them you just wanna run to them and control or interact with them. For anyone that is that old, remember how you had to place a spawn beacon back in Battlefield vietnam, you had to pick it up under a helicopter fly and land it somewhere..... Or take ages to dig a tunnel entrance.... oooe the spiked log traps you could crush whole squads with.
I understand we will never see a controllable aircraft carrier and I wouldn't even want to tbh, would just be a gimmick to bring that back and many of those things that used to work don't work anymore in video games. But it's the idea there are some cool features, some special things to figure out and try out. Hell who doesn't instantly run to that cool vehicle, cannon or what not in the hope it's controllable or interactable in some way. Instead we get doors we can open or close with a button or bridges which can open which havent been touched since the first week of the game. I remember the bollards from the Rao video, honestly I bet it's just put in the game just for that marketing video nothing else.
Think Battlefield 1 did it pretty well and actually made it part of the core design and Battlefield 5 in some ways with the squad unlocks. But with 2042 they sorta still did it with the massive amount of dadgets and specialist perks but it's so widespread that's it's a watered down version and it loses all the fun and excitement.
Just imagine if the grapple hook, wingsuits or NTW where pickups.... much better design imo and in turn those things could be even more powerful and fun. You can't balance something when there could potentially be 128 players using the same thing, hence the watered down experience.
